There's a list in the guides section under SP farming and masteries, but I'll list some for you right now.
Imbue: First skill under ice, lightning, and fire branches. Force skill tree does not have an imbue.
PvE: Player versus Environment; refers to lvling when a player is killing monsters.
PvP: Player versus Player; when player fights against another player or players, in a contest to see who is stronger. Requires a cape that can be bought from the grocery trader in each town. All capes make you friendly with other players wearing the same color, except the orange cape.
Pk: In general: When another player kills another player. In SRO: When a player who is not wearing a job item or cape, attacks another player who is not wearing a job item or cape, and kills them. The pker then recieves "murderer status" and will recieve constant damage when in town, and any one can attack him or her without penalty, until murderer status is gone.
Nukers: A character with a high magical balance who uses the second to last skill under ice, lightning or fire.
Nukes: Refers to the most powerful spell or skill, usually associated with mages, casters, or in this game "nukers".
Tankers: Characters with a high amount of HP who can "tank" alot of damage from attacks. They often have a high physical balance, and may or may not wear armor, and might favor garment instead.
HP: Hit points.
MP: Mana points.
Parry: Factor that reduces the possiblity of the attacker doing a higher DoT than normal. Is affected by attack rating of attacker.
Attack rating: Factor that increases the possibility of doing a higher DoT than normal. Is affected by parry. In general, it is good to have a high parry and attack rating, and that your enemy has lower parry and attack rating.
DoT or DoTs: Damage over Time. Refers to how much damage can be dealt in a shorter/faster amount of time. A player than can hit a monster for 100 damage every 2 seconds, has better DoTs than a player that hits a monster for 100 damage every 3 seconds.
Chain skills: Also known as "combos". Refers to the skills in any of the three weapon trees, that allow a player to hit a target several times very quickly.
Thief bug: When a high lvl player thief, uses a camel to spawn NPC thieves to attack 1 star traders to steal their goods.
1-star or 1-star trader: Traders that cannot be attacked by player thieves, but can be attacked by NPC thieves during a trade run.
Stars: Refers to the number of "stars" in the bottom left area of a transport's inventory. Also refers to the difficulty of the trade run, and affects how much trader experience will be given to the player. Any trader that has 2 or more stars can be attacked by player thieves.
